*1: [Tint] can be displayed and adjusted only when the video signal is set to [NTSC] or [NTSC4.43].
*2: [Noise reduction] may not work depending on signal type.
*3: [NTSC mode] can be displayed and adjusted only when the video signal is set to [NTSC] or
[NTSC4.43]. NTSC mode is set to JAPAN when the language is set to Japanese. It is set to US for
other languages.
*4: If the output settings of the connected device are incorrectly set, black and dark areas of the
picture may not be displayed properly.
